Crypto Fear and Greed Index Climbs to Neutral Territory
The Crypto Fear and Greed Index, a metric that measures market sentiment in cryptocurrencies, has risen to 40. This marks a shift from fear to neutral territory, indicating that investors are no longer as pessimistic as they were earlier in the week.
The index aggregates multiple data points, including price movements of top 10 cryptocurrencies by market capitalization, market volatility, derivatives data, and stablecoin supply ratio. A reading of 0 signals extreme fear, while 100 reflects extreme greed.
A neutral reading around 40 suggests that investors are balanced, with neither overwhelming fear nor exuberance dominating trading behavior. This can signal an opportunity for traders to accumulate assets at relatively stable prices.
